Established in 1884, Marks and Spencer began as a market stall in Leeds. Michael Marks classified his goods by price, and the "penny bazaar" section thrived. Tom Spencer became his business partner. The company gained a reputation for its British-made products and its free returns policy.

H&M

H&M is a fashion retailer with a global presence. The headquarters of the company are located in Stockholm, Sweden. The company's business model is fast fashion. model, which means the brand introduces new styles often. It also collaborates with designers to develop a special collections for the company. The company has been criticized for its treatment of employees as well as racial or cultural appropriation. However, it has made some improvements in recent years. The company has a clothing collecting program where customers can drop off their old clothes at store locations. The company will reuse them or turn them into other textiles.

ASOS has introduced a new feature that helps customers find the right style for their body. The new feature called See My Fit uses augmented reality in order to digitally map a selected dress onto the model that is most appropriate to the body type of the customer. This makes online shopping easier and makes customers feel more confident in the item.

Motel is the best place to go for trend-led fashion that has an old-fashioned feel. The brand was founded on a road trip across America the founders Will and Andy now divide their time between London and Bali to develop the brand's main collections and cool girl-friendly edits. Find bold prints, statement outfits and party dresses in sizes from UK6 to 16.
